The Analysis
SAHL is a high-energy, vibrant yellow that acts as an instant light source, making rooms feel significantly brighter and more expansive. Because of its high Light Reflectance Value (LRV) of 67.4, it effectively bounces natural light around the space, which is perfect for lifting the mood in darker corners.
This is a bold, spirited choice best used as a feature wall or for cabinetry to add character. If you’re feeling adventurous, it works beautifully in high-traffic areas like entryways or kitchens where you want to create a welcoming, high-impact first impression.

Colour harmonies
Complementary
Opposite on the colour wheel — bold, high-contrast pairings. Use for a feature wall or furniture you want to command attention.
Analogous
Neighbouring hues — cohesive and calm, great for layered schemes that feel collected rather than matched.
Split complementary
Near-opposites for strong contrast with a little less tension than a pure complement. A favourite of interior designers.
Triadic
Three evenly spaced hues — balanced, vibrant, and versatile. Keep one dominant and use the others sparingly.
Tetradic (square)
Four hues in a square on the wheel — rich, dynamic palettes. Best when one colour leads and the others accent.
Monochromatic
Dark, mid, and light steps on the same hue — a failsafe gradient for trim, walls, and accents without shifting colour family.
